Q.3 Which of the following statements regarding cloud storage and cloud computing is most accurate?
A
Within the financial sector, all major banks have adopted multicloud computing.
B
The increased use of cloud computing in recent years by banks has resulted in decreases in both cyber and ICT risks.
C
The advance of cloud storage and computing has allowed ICT risks and cybersecurity risks to be treated independently for analytical purposes.
D
A cloud services audit firm has recently reported that about 50% of cloud customers have experienced a physical outage in the past three years.
